They Don't Pay? We Won't Pay!
SYNOPSIS:
Prices are rising and wages are falling—what’s a girl to do? Go shopping for free without letting your husband (or the police) know. Classic commedia dell’arte meets the Honeymooners! At the heart of all the high jinks is a basic human need—hunger—and the very human desire to satisfy that need with one’s dignity intact. This playful romp ultimately illuminates the buoyancy and resilience of the human spirit as it comes up against everyday life in this side-splitting satire.
